Abstract

The utility model relates to a horn, and particularly relates to an ultrathin pressure-resistant horn applied to a thin music greeting card. The ultrathin pressure-resistant horn comprises an outer framework and a horn body, wherein the horn body is mounted on the outer framework; a vent hole is formed in the outer framework; the outer framework is a round thin sheet; the horn body is mounted at the center of the outer framework; reinforcing bars are fixed on the back face of the outer framework, and are uniformly distributed outward from the center of the outer framework in a radial shape. The horn provided by the utility model is better than the traditional music horn. The reinforcing bars are arranged on the outer framework, so that the strength of the horn is greatly improved, the pressure-resistance is improved, and the horn is more firm and is difficult to damage.

Description

A kind of ultra-thin withstand voltage loudspeaker
Technical field
The utility model relates to a kind of loudspeaker, particularly a kind of ultra-thin withstand voltage loudspeaker that are applied on slim music greeting card.
Background technology
Be applied in the loudspeaker on music greeting card or toy on the open market, because the material of its outer casing framework adopts plastics more, and horn main body is thinner, the situation of outer casing rupture often occurs in the process that transportation is used, a little less than external force resistance impulse withstand voltage ability.
The utility model content
The purpose of this utility model is to overcome existing the problems referred to above in prior art, and a kind of reasonable in design, anti-pressure ability are strong, non-damageable ultra-thin withstand voltage loudspeaker and provide.
The utility model solves the problems of the technologies described above the technical scheme that adopts: these ultra-thin withstand voltage loudspeaker, comprise outer skeleton and horn body, on outer skeleton, horn body is installed, have air vent hole on outer skeleton, it is characterized in that, described outer skeleton is thin rounded flakes, and horn body is arranged on outer skeleton center, be fixed with reinforcement on the back side of described outer skeleton, reinforcement is from the outwards radial even distribution of outer skeleton center.Be provided with the intensity that reinforcement can promote this product greatly, make the anti-pressure ability of this product stronger, not fragile.
As preferably, the number of described reinforcement is the 6-12 bar, and air vent hole is opened between reinforcement.
As preferably, described reinforcement has six, and air vent hole has six, and reinforcement and air vent hole are intervally arranged.
As preferably, described reinforcement has 12, and air vent hole has six, and every two reinforcements are intervally arranged as interval and air vent hole.More reinforcement can further promote the intensity of this product.
The beneficial effects of the utility model are: be better than traditional music loudspeaker, be provided with reinforcement on the outer casing framework of this product, greatly promoted the intensity of loudspeaker, improved its measuring body performance, loudspeaker are more solid, and are also not fragile.
